Gedik to open a new plant in southern Bulgaria

4 March 2016

Turkish company Gedik Welding plans to build a 2,000 sqm production facility in Kurdzhali, in southern Bulgaria. Local authorities announced that the Turkish company, represented by the board chairman Hulia Gedik, already discussed the details of the project with Kurdzali mayor Hasan Azis.

Gedik Welding was founded in 1963 and manufactures about 90,000 tons/year of welding products, consumables and machines.
